Enclosed Car Transport
Enclosed demand rises for high-value, specialty, or seasonal vehicles. Enclosed trailers protect against road debris and weather, which matters on a coast-to-coast route.
According to industry estimates from the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ration, enclosed carriers make up less than 10 percent of active auto transport capacity, and that explains the higher cost and limited availability.
Open Car Transport
Most vehicles move on open trailers, and for many people that is the cheapest way to ship car from California to Florida.
Open transport works well for standard vehicles and keeps costs predictable. It also offers the widest carrier availability.
